Background
With the continuous development of society, the living standard of people is also continuously improved. Modern life style and living environment lead people to attach more and more importance to beautification and environmental protection of the environment, and garden construction is attached more and more to people. A lot of ornamental trees and shrubs or lawns are inevitable to have a lot of fallen leaves in autumn, fallen leaves, petals and the like can fly with the wind, the attractiveness of gardens is greatly influenced, and the daily trip of urban images and residents is also influenced. The accumulated dry fallen leaves may also present a safety hazard of spontaneous combustion, and therefore, the fallen leaves in gardens need to be cleaned.
Traditional mode of clearance fallen leaves is swept through sanitationman's use hand to pick up or broom, and intensity of labour is big, and work efficiency is low, and fallen leaves too many lead to clearance and transportation all inconvenient moreover, waste time and energy, in order to solve the problem that exists in the aforesaid, consequently, we provide a gardens fallen leaves cleaning device.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1-4, a garden fallen leaf cleaning device comprises a box body 1, an inlet pipe 3, a push plate 5, a dustbin 12, a crushing box 20 and a push rod 16;
four idler wheels 13 are symmetrically and fixedly installed at the bottom of the box body 1, a crushing box 20 is arranged in the center of an inner cavity of the box body 1, the top of the crushing box 20 is fixedly connected with the top of the inner cavity of the box body 1, a second motor 19 is fixedly installed in the center of the top of the inner cavity of the crushing box 20, a plurality of groups of rotary blades 17 are fixedly installed on a downward motor shaft of the second motor 19 in a staggered manner, a vibration motor 18 is fixed at the top of the right side wall of the motor shaft of the second motor 19, the type of the vibration motor is HY, an inlet pipe 3 is fixedly connected to the bottom of the outer wall of the left side of the crushing box 20, the left side of the inlet pipe 3 penetrates through the left side wall of the box body 1 and extends to the outside of the box body 1, a suction head 4 is fixedly installed at one end of the inlet pipe 3, the, an outlet pipe 11 is fixedly connected to the right side of the bottom of the crushing box 20, and a garbage can 12 is connected to one end, far away from the crushing box 20, of the outlet pipe 11 in a threaded mode;
two backup pads 24 of symmetry fixed mounting around 1 inner chamber bottom of box, and backup pad 24 is circularly, backup pad 24 central authorities run through to rotate and are connected with fixed axle 8, 8 top fixed mounting of fixed axle have first motor 10, 8 outer wall fixed mounting of fixed axle has dead lever 9, the one end that fixed axle 8 was kept away from to dead lever 9 articulates there is transfer line 7, the one end that dead lever 9 was kept away from to transfer line 7 articulates there is push pedal 5, and push pedal 5 arranges box 1 outside in, 1 positive surperficial central authorities of box articulate there is chamber door 23, 1 positive surperficial lower right position of box evenly is equipped with a plurality of louvres 21, 1 left side outer wall top front and back symmetry fixed mounting of box has.
Wherein the inlet pipe 3 is a flexible hose.
Wherein, a plurality of rake teeth 6 are fixedly arranged at the bottom of the two push plates 5 along the length direction.
Wherein, a filter screen 25 is fixedly arranged in the inner cavity of the horizontal part at the top of the air suction pipe 15, and the outer wall of the horizontal part at the top of the push rod 16 is sleeved with a sponge sleeve.
Wherein, the upper right position of the front surface of the box body 1 is fixedly provided with a control switch 22, and the illuminating lamp 2, the first motor 10, the fan 14, the vibration motor 18 and the second motor 19 are all electrically connected with the control switch 22.
The utility model discloses during the use: after being externally connected with a power-on wire, the cleaning device is moved by utilizing a push rod 16 and a roller 13, a first motor 10 is started through a control switch 23, the first motor 10 drives a fixed shaft 8 to rotate so as to drive a fixed rod 9 to rotate, the fixed rod 9 drives a transmission rod 7 to rotate, the transmission rod 7 drives a push plate 5 to swing left and right, fallen leaves are swept out by rake teeth 6 at the bottom of the push plate 5, the fallen leaves are stacked together by the push plate 5, an inlet pipe 3 is adjusted, a fan 14 is started through a control switch 22, the fallen leaves are sucked in by a suction head 4 and sucked into a crushing box 20 through the inlet pipe 3, a second motor 19 is started through the control switch 22, the second motor 19 drives a rotary blade 17 to rotate to cut and crush the fallen leaves, the crushed fallen leaves fall into a garbage box 12 through an outlet pipe 11, the garbage box 12 is taken out, the fallen leaves are poured out, if the crushing effect is, leave the remaining fallen leaves piece on the rotary blade 17 and shake off, when working under the environment of night or light difference, open light 2 through control switch 22 and throw light on, the design is simple, comparatively practical.
